  Job Summary

  Under the direction of management and physician leadership, performs and oversees functions related to the clinical activities including, but not limited to: maintains patient flow by assisting and promoting the delivery of primary and preventative health care, performs technical procedures, lab protocols and clinically oriented activities under physician/provider direction. The Medical Assistant III will assist management in achieving office efficiencies in accordance with stated policies/procedures to ensure efficient operations with a focus on supporting physicians, clinic staff and management which embodies the "Service First" philosophy to promote customer satisfaction.

  Essential Functions

  Acts as an assistant to the physician/provider by providing primary healthcare and patient care management.

  Collaborates work efforts with the clerical staff to optimize operations and patient flow.

  Interacts with outside healthcare facilities and agencies involving patient care and insurance.

  Maintains updated competencies, demonstrating ability to speak to leadership and accreditation bodies about process and workflow.

  Perform front office duties to provide coverage as needed.

  Provide coverage in other departments or locations as needed.

  Demonstrates excellent customer services skills and supports the model of patient and family centered care.

  Performs and is formally assigned (2) of the additional responsibilities as part of their primary duties, which should be at least 20% or more of dedicated time:Primary Care gaps in care identification, outreach, and chart preparationResidency clinic roleHigh level disinfectionDesignated new hire preceptorRole in practice participating in or leading special programs/grants (i.e. CPC Plus, SIM, Vaccine for Child Program, process improvement, service excellence ambassador)Care management (PDCMs)Qualified language interpreterSuper User for EPIC or specific competencyAdvanced provider support – assisting with complex procedures and/or infusion/chemo scheduling.Multi-site/flexible float pool assignment

  Qualifications

  Required High School Diploma or equivalent

  Required Completion of an accredited MA program, including a clinical rotation, or equivalent experience.

  1 year of relevant experience Twelve (12) months MA work experience or a completed Beaumont MA internship and (6) months MA work experience Required

  2 years of relevant experience  2-3 years of MA experience Preferred

  CRT-Basic Life Support (BLS) - AHA American Heart Association Upon Hire required Or

  CRT-Basic Life Support (BLS) - ARC American Red Cross Upon Hire required

  CRT-At least one Certification from preferred list - UNKNOWN Unknown Upon Hire preferred

  CRT-Medical Assistant, Certified (CMA) - AAMA American Association of Medical Assistants 90 Days required Or

  CRT-Medical Assistant, Registered (RMA) - AMT American Medical Technologists 90 Days required Or

  CRT-Medical Assistant, Certified (NCMA) - NCCT National Center for Competency Testing 90 Days required Or

  CRT-Medical Assistant, Certified (CCMA) - NHA National Healthcareer Association 90 Days required Or

  LIC-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) - STATE_MI State of Michigan 90 Days required Or

  LIC-License Practical Nursing (LPN) - STATE_MI State of Michigan 90 Days required
